Solar panel power generation efficiency in South Africa during winter
During winter, the Southern Hemisphere of the Earth is tilted away from the sun, receiving less direct sunlight compared to summer. This results in lower solar panel efficiency and shorter daylight hours. Although South Africa gets copious amounts of sunshine for much of the year, it is not immune to the impact of winter on solar power. . South African winters are often crisp, clear, and full of sunlight, which are ideal conditions for solar panels – or so it seems. But as many solar users are discovering, blue skies don't always guarantee peak performance. FAQS about Solar power station investment efficiency
Why is the efficiency of photovoltaic systems important?
The efficiency of photovoltaic systems is crucial in maximizing performance and ensuring their economic and environmental viability in large-scale applications. Several technological, ecological, design, installation, and operational factors directly influence the ability of these systems to convert solar radiation into usable energy.
What factors affect the performance of photovoltaic solar systems (PSS)?
PSS (Photovoltaic Solar Systems) are a key technology in energy transition, and their efficiency depends on multiple interrelated factors. This study uses a systematic review based on the PRISMA methodology to identify four main categories affecting performance: technological, environmental, design and installation, and operational factors.
